QC Photo Documentation: Best Practices & Tools
Maintaining thorough QC photo documentation is vital for manufacturing processes. It supplies a visual record of product standard at various stages, aiding in defect examination, root cause determination, and process refinement. Best practices involve using consistent lighting, backgrounds, and angles for each assessment. Clearly label each photo with relevant data like date, time, product ID, and defect description. Several tools can support this process. High-resolution cameras, even smartphone cameras, can be sufficient if used correctly. Specialized QC software can optimize image capture, organization, and documentation. Cloud-based storage systems enable easy access and collaboration. Periodic review and modification of documentation procedures ensures precision and potency. Don’t underestimate the power of a well-documented issue; it's a worthwhile asset for continuous improvement. Investing time and resources into robust photo documentation pays dividends in lessened rework, improved reliability, and enhanced customer contentment.

QC Doppelgangers: Identifying Fault Patterns
In testing control, recognizing recurring defects – or “QC Doppelgangers” – is vital for forward-looking improvement. These aren't identical copies of the same imperfection; rather, they are defects that share underlying causes or manifest in similar ways. Identifying these patterns moves teams beyond reactive firefighting and towards a more strategic approach to prevention. Analyzing defect data – from bug reports, code reviews, and testing results – can reveal these common "doppelgangers." Look for similarities in the sections of the code affected, the kinds of errors, or the phases of the development process where they originate. Using tools for root cause analysis and utilizing techniques like Pareto charts can emphasize the most prevalent defect patterns. By addressing these underlying influences, teams can considerably reduce future occurrences and improve overall product dependability. This preventive approach isn't just about fixing separate bugs – it's about building a more robust and resilient development process.

QC Photo Analysis: Spotting Subtle Flaws
Quality of photographs goes far beyond simply checking for obvious defects. Truly effective QC photo analysis requires a keen eye for subtle flaws that might otherwise go unnoticed. These imperfections, while not immediately harmful, can accumulate and significantly impact the complete image quality, or even render a product unusable. Approaches like pixel peeping – examining images at high magnification – are crucial for identifying issues like dust spots, minor scratches, or variations in color balance. Additionally, understanding common photographic errors – such as motion blur, focus errors, or illumination problems – allows for targeted inspection. It’s not qc photos just about *seeing* the flaws, but knowing their potential impact and prioritizing them according to their severity. A thorough QC process will also consider factors like sharpness, contrast, and dynamic range, ensuring that every image meets the required standards. In conclusion, mastering the art of spotting subtle flaws is essential for maintaining high-quality visual output and supplying consistently excellent results.
